Abstract
For simulating electrical energy transducers, transient 3D finite-elements models are used. Since the behaviour of electrotechnical devices is highly influenced by the driving electrical network, such models have to be extended by circuits. This paper discusses advanced field-circuit coupling techniques, models for the coils appearing in the finite-element model and appropriate solution techniques. Moreover, switching elements such as e.g. diodes and thyristors, are considered.
